What insurance companies are in Florida?
**There are numerous insurance companies operating in the state of Florida. Some of the most prominent ones include State Farm, Allstate, GEICO, Progressive, and USAA. These companies offer a wide range of insurance products to Florida residents to protect their homes, cars, health, and more.**

2. Are there any local insurance companies in Florida?
Yes, there are several local insurance companies in Florida that cater to the specific needs of residents in the state. Some examples include Florida Peninsula Insurance Company and Tower Hill Insurance.

9. Are there any specific insurance requirements in Florida?
Yes, Florida has specific insurance requirements for auto insurance, including minimum coverage limits for bodily injury and property damage liability. It’s important to comply with these requirements to drive legally in the state.

12. Are there any government regulations for insurance companies in Florida?
Yes, insurance companies in Florida are regulated by the Florida Office of Insurance Regulation, which oversees their operations, rates, solvency, and compliance with state laws and regulations.
